The only thing I did on my sons car when I built it was put the rear springs on the outer hole and put some larger washers under the rear pod between o rings and pod as the standard ones tend to work themselves through the hole and hold the rear pod at funny angle making the car corner good one way and bad the other and that was about it and put the stickers on tyres as it helps to stop them getting chunked
Run kit settings, run as low as possible. If you got the diff, strip, degrease, relube, adjust as tighten fully, back off one whole turn and then a 1/16th.
